I am Male planning for baby but can't intercourse daily - #794
Sanjeev Pujari
I am 40 year old planning for baby but can't intercourse daily and I have bp of 160 and taking medication
Age: 40
Chronic illnesses: Hypertension taking medication for BP

As you plan for a baby at the age of 40 while managing hypertension, it’s essential to approach this journey with care, particularly regarding your health and fertility. Ayurveda emphasizes the importance of balancing physical and mental well-being to enhance fertility. Regular monitoring of your blood pressure is crucial, and it’s advisable to consult with your healthcare provider about the safety and potential adjustments of your hypertension medication while trying to conceive.
In terms of improving your chances of conception, consider incorporating lifestyle changes that promote overall health. A balanced diet rich in fresh f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and healthy fats is vital. Foods such as almonds, walnuts, sesame seeds, and ghee can nourish reproductive tissues. Ayurvedic herbs like Ashwagandha and Shatavari may also be beneficial; they help reduce stress and balance hormones, supporting reproductive health.
Engaging in regular, gentle exercises, such as walking or yoga, can improve circulation and reduce stress levels, both of which are beneficial for blood pressure management and fertility. Practicing relaxation techniques, such as meditation or deep breathing exercises, can also help manage stress and support hormonal balance.
While daily intercourse can be beneficial, it’s essential to listen to your body and ensure that you’re not putting undue stress on yourself. Finding a rhythm that works for both you and your partner can be more effective than strict schedules.

Understandable that it can be a concern but no worries, let's break this down. First, it’s a good thing you're planning ahead. Considering your blood pressure, maintaining good health is key. Elevated BP can affect overall health, including fertility, so management is necessary. Keep following your doctor’s medication regimen and monitor your BP regularly.
Regarding daily intercourse, it’s not necessary for conception. Timing is more crucial. Focus on the fertile window, which is around five days prior to ovulation and the day of ovulation itself. Tracking your partner’s menstrual cycle can help identify the best days for conception—you can use apps or ovulation kits for more accuracy.
From an Ayurvedic viewpoint, it’s vital to improve the quality of Shukra dhatu (reproductive tissue). Diet plays a huge role. Include warming, nourishing foods—like nuts, sesame seeds, ghee, and milk in your diet. They're beneficial for reproductive health. Ashwagandha or Shatavari supplements might be helpful too, but check with your doctor as you're on medication.
Stress reduction is paramount. High BP and stress might correlate, so consider meditation or yoga to soothe the mind. A light practice of Pranayama (breathing exercises) can also be incredibly beneficial. Rest is important too, don't overlook the power of a good night's sleep, ok?!
Try minimizing caffeine and alcohol—it can mess with BP even more. Avoid overly salty foods as well, as these won't do favors for your BP levels. Stay hydrated. Water is your friend.
If stress or BP management seem challenging, consulting an Ayurvedic practitioner nearby may provide tailored advice. Incorporating these practices could create a healthier environment for conception while supporting your overall well-being.
